According to the Mirror, Arsenal fc intends to sign Sokratis Papastathopoulos, Stephan Lichtsteiner and Caglar Soyuncu before the world cup tournament coming up in two weeks.

Unai Emery is venturing into doing extremely well at the Emirates with the defence appearing to be the first area due for an overhaul.

Following CalcioMercato reports, The Gunners are reportedly weighing up a deal for Sampdoria midfielder Lucas Torreira.
Everton are also keen into bringing the 22-year-old, who is inclusive in the Uruguay's World Cup squad, and has a declared €25m (£21.8m) release clause.

Former Gunner's renowned striker, Olivier Giroud stated he moved to Chelsea to maintain his world cup hopes.
Olivier Giroud has also credited his move from Arsenal to Chelsea with reviving his form in time for the World Cup.

"I had to impose myself at Chelsea," he told the London Evening Standard . "I've always been lucky enough to have made the right decisions, if I can say that. I've always felt that I've had good fortune in that way.

"It's not just about making the right choice. You have to make your mark too. I had the chance to do that and I'm very happy. It's a development in my career in terms of my club.

"I feel very good there and it was definitely a new challenge that was needed for my development, for the rest of my career, and also for the World Cup."
